![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Регистрация: 06.04.2009
Сообщений: 7
|
![]()
Привет всем! Помогите с заданием.
Дана матрица A(n,m) Необходимо: упорядочить элементы в каждом столбце матрицы по убыванию, а сами расположить по убыванию кол-во ненулевых элементов в столбце. Матрица выводится через Stringgrid. Начальный код: var Form1: TForm1; i,j:integer; f: array of integer; max: integer; implementation {$R *.dfm} procedure TForm1.Button1Click(Sender: TObject); begin try // присвоилb введенное значение i - кол-во столбцов i:=strtoint(edit1.text); except // ошибка on EconvertError do ShowMessage('Введите число'); end; try // присвоилb введенное значение j - кол-во сток j:=strtoint(edit2.text); except // ошибка on EconvertError do ShowMessage('Введите число'); end; begin StringGrid1.RowCount:=i; // выводим количество столбцов StringGrid1.ColCount:=j; // выводим количество строк end; end; procedure TForm1.Button2Click(Sender: TObject); var i,j: integer; begin // заполняем данную матрицу случайным выбором for i:=0 to StringGrid1.ColCount-1 do for j:=0 to stringgrid1.RowCount-1 do begin StringGrid1.Cells[i,j]:=inttostr(random(100)); end; end; |
![]() |
![]() |
![]() |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Задание на Delphi | Bimmer71 | Помощь студентам | 1 | 10.12.2009 23:02 |
задание на С | blackbanny | Помощь студентам | 2 | 15.10.2009 09:39 |
Delphi. Помогите сделать задание. | procomp | Помощь студентам | 2 | 01.10.2009 01:22 |
Текстовый файл и очень простое задание DELPHI | 08ekhiv1 | Помощь студентам | 10 | 03.03.2009 00:28 |